MM74HC4053SJ Equivalent & Substitute Parts

Part Overview

The MM74HC4053SJ is a 3-circuit SPDT (Single Pole Double Throw) analog switch IC manufactured by onsemi, designed for signal routing and multiplexing applications in 16-SOP surface mount packaging. This part is classified as obsolete, making equivalent substitutes necessary for new designs and ongoing production requirements. The device operates across a wide supply voltage range and provides low on-state resistance suitable for audio and signal switching applications.

Engineering Selection Recommendations

CD74HC4053NSR (Texas Instruments) is the primary substitute for MM74HC4053SJ. This part maintains identical supply voltage specifications (2V ~ 6V single supply, ±1V ~ 5V dual supply) and package dimensions (16-SOIC 0.209" width). The on-state resistance of 130Ω exceeds the original specification by 30Ω, which is acceptable for most signal routing applications. The extended operating temperature range (-55°C ~ 125°C) provides broader environmental coverage. This part carries Last Time Buy status, indicating limited future availability.

HEF4053BT,653 (Nexperia) serves as a secondary substitute with Active product status, ensuring long-term availability. The 16-SOIC package has a reduced width of 0.154" (3.90mm) compared to the original 0.209" specification, requiring PCB footprint verification before implementation. The on-state resistance of 155Ω and leakage current of 200nA represent measurable increases from the original specifications. The extended single supply voltage range (3V ~ 15V) accommodates higher voltage applications. This part is ROHS3 compliant.

Both substitutes maintain the core 3-circuit SPDT 2:1 multiplexer topology and surface mount configuration required for direct functional replacement.

Frequently Asked Questions (FAQ)

Q: Can CD74HC4053NSR replace MM74HC4053SJ in existing designs?

A: Yes. The CD74HC4053NSR maintains identical package dimensions (16-SOIC 0.209" width) and supply voltage specifications. The 30Ω increase in on-state resistance (130Ω vs. 100Ω) is within acceptable tolerance for analog signal switching applications where impedance matching is not critical.

Q: What is the primary limitation of HEF4053BT,653 as a substitute?

A: The HEF4053BT,653 uses a narrower 16-SOIC package (0.154" width vs. 0.209" width). PCB footprint compatibility must be verified before implementation. The increased on-state resistance (155Ω) and leakage current (200nA) may impact performance in precision signal routing applications.

Q: Are there supply voltage compatibility issues with these substitutes?

A: CD74HC4053NSR operates within 2V ~ 6V single supply, matching the original specification. HEF4053BT,653 requires minimum 3V single supply, which may limit use in 2V applications. Dual supply operation differs between parts; verify specific voltage requirements for your application.

Q: Do these substitutes maintain the same crosstalk performance?

A: CD74HC4053NSR does not specify crosstalk performance. HEF4053BT,653 matches the original -50dB @ 1MHz crosstalk specification. For applications requiring crosstalk control, HEF4053BT,653 provides documented performance equivalence.

Q: What is the impact of different operating temperature ranges?

A: CD74HC4053NSR extends to -55°C ~ 125°C, providing broader environmental coverage than the original -40°C ~ 85°C range. HEF4053BT,653 covers -40°C ~ 125°C. Both substitutes support the original temperature range and exceed it at the upper limit.

Q: Which substitute offers better long-term availability?

A: HEF4053BT,653 carries Active product status, ensuring continued manufacturing and supply. CD74HC4053NSR is designated Last Time Buy, indicating limited future availability. For new designs requiring long-term component sourcing, HEF4053BT,653 is the preferred choice.
